Adelaide hotel stunned by power cost

The Belair Hotel in Adelaide has been hit with a 45% jump in the off-peak component of its monthly power bill due to the carbon tax.

Its January account came in at $15,494.83 compared with its July bill of $19,092.65 – due in part to a leap from 4.5 cents per kilowatt hour to 6.51 cents a kWh, according to Belair director Brett Matthews.
The reason listed on the July bill was “carbon adjustment”.
Mr Matthews said he was “stunned” by the amount and said the extra cost would mean “jobs or prices”.
